Establishes the Rights of the Dan River Ecosystem Act, creating legal rights for the Dan River watershed including its mainstem, tributaries, and dependent species to exist, flourish, recover, and maintain clean water and natural biodiversity.
-
Grants North Carolina residents the right to a healthy Dan River ecosystem and preserves collective and individual rights of indigenous peoples residing in the state.
-
Requires natural resource management agencies (Department of Natural and Cultural Resources, Department of Environmental Quality, and Wildlife Resources Commission) to review existing policies by June 30, 2025, conduct a baseline environmental assessment by that date, remedy violations by June 30, 2026, and complete full ecosystem restoration by June 30, 2029.
-
Authorizes the Attorney General, the Dan River ecosystem itself, and any North Carolina resident to bring legal actions to enforce these rights with remedies including injunctive relief and damages for natural resource violations.
-
Establishes civil penalties of up to $10,000 per occurrence (or $500 per day for continuing violations, trebled if willful) and makes violating entities strictly liable for restoration costs; appropriates $100,000 to each natural resource management agency for implementation.
